A four-part exposition on the human condition: humorous and offbeat stories from an unemployed sociology professor forced by an economic downturn to drive a taxi for a living; school confessions from a misspent youth; recollections from a single parent trying to raise his eccentric daughter; and reflections on the lives of two remarkable parents. A psychological and philosophical inquiry into the foibles of life and the triumph of the human spirit.
